A woman was allegedly burnt alive by a priest after she resisted his advances in a village in Damoh district of Madhya Pradesh. The woman succumbed to her injuries in a hospital on July 10, a report said quoting police sources. The 27-year Vinita Patel, in her dying declaration to the police reportedly said, “The priest, Devki Prasad Tiwari, entered my house in a bid to outrage my modesty and when I protested, he doused me with kerosene and burnt me.” The incident took place in village Piprodha Chakkar in Damoh, 280 km from Bhopal. “She was immediately rushed to a nearby hospital from where she was referred to Jabalpur medical hospital where she died this evening,” a police official said, adding, “We have registered a case on the basis of the dying woman’s declaration and are investigating the matter,” Damoh police superintendent Dilip Arya said.
